BaseTensor

功能

定义一个张量数据的结构。

结构定义

1
2
3
4
5
struct BaseTensor { 
     void* buf; 
     std::vector<int> shape; 
     size_t size; 
 }

参数说明

参数名

说明

buf

张量的数据。

shape

张量的形状。

size

张量数据对应内存大小,单位为Byte。

size大小应与实际内存大小一致,否则可能会导致程序出现coredump情况。